What lessons can we learn from the healing of the man with the withered hand?

The healing teaches about God's power to transform lives and the importance of faith in His commands.

The story of the healing of the man with the withered hand in Luke 6 serves as a powerful illustration of the transforming grace of God. This miracle not only showcases Jesus' authority over physical ailments but also symbolizes His ability to restore the spiritually broken. The man's act of stretching forth his hand at Jesus' command points to the necessity of faith and obedience in response to God's word. The narrative challenges self-righteousness and emphasizes that salvation and healing come solely through Christ's initiative and grace.
Scripture References: Luke 6:6-10, John 15:5
